The Foot Fist Way
2006
⏱️ 83 min
📅 Released
🌐 EN
Comedy
An inept taekwondo instructor struggles with marital troubles and an unhealthy obsession with fellow taekwondo enthusiast Chuck "The Truck" Williams.
